Simcoe Liqour Store

No Photo for Simcoe Liqour Store

83 Sydenham St, Simcoe, Ontario N3Y 1R8
(519) 426-2115

Contact Simcoe Liqour Store

Your Name:
Your Email:
Do not fill this field in:
Your Phone #:
Subject:
Message: